Efficacy of baclofen and phenobarbital against the kainic acid limbic seizure-brain damage syndrome.

Abstract

Baclofen and phenobarbital were tested for anticonvulsant efficacy against limbic seizures produced by i.c.v. infusion of kainic acid (KA) in unanesthetized rats. All rats treated with KA alone developed a prolonged status epilepticus associated with extensive neuronal degeneration. When administered immediately after the KA infusion, baclofen (5 mg/kg i.p.) protected five of six animals against the development of status epilepticus and did not alter the behavioral expression of the residual discrete electrographic seizures. Phenobarbital (40 mg/kg i.p.) given 15 min before KA also prevented the development of status epilepticus in five of six rats, but blocked the behavioral expression of the residual electrographic seizures. In two of five additional rats, baclofen prevented or reversed status epilepticus when administered 50 to 60 min after the end of the KA infusion. The ability of these drugs to prevent KA-induced neuronal degeneration correlated with their anticonvulsant action.

在未麻醉的大鼠中,测试了巴氯芬和苯巴比妥对脑室内注射 kainic 酸(KA)诱发的边缘叶癫痫发作的抗惊厥疗效。所有单独接受 KA 治疗的大鼠均出现了与广泛神经元变性相关的长时间癫痫持续状态。在 KA 注射后立即给药时,巴氯芬(腹腔注射 5 mg/kg)保护了六只动物中的五只免受癫痫持续状态的发展,并且没有改变残余离散脑电图癫痫发作的行为表现。在 KA 注射前 15 分钟给予苯巴比妥(腹腔注射 40 mg/kg)也预防了六只大鼠中五只的癫痫持续状态发展,但阻断了残余脑电图癫痫发作的行为表现。在另外五只大鼠中的两只中,巴氯芬在 KA 注射结束后 50 至 60 分钟给药时预防或逆转了癫痫持续状态。这些药物预防 KA 诱导的神经元变性的能力与其抗惊厥作用相关。
